Output 2efa8a0333ff7faa2f7a83eee038664cf4bc7f1c341d87aa712e6d5ee5f1c2d2:2

value
889750984
script pubkey
OP_HASH160 OP_PUSHBYTES_20 597dc8955f2f31c9470f1c56a979232cf09402ec OP_EQUAL
address
39rCkD6yCufy3xu8WZUZkey9EJghYugrTx
transaction
2efa8a0333ff7faa2f7a83eee038664cf4bc7f1c341d87aa712e6d5ee5f1c2d2
confirmations
352003
spent
true